Phuong maintains the massage therapy industry's highest credential- Board Certification in Therapeutic Massage and Bodywork (BCTMB). Maintaining Board Certification goes above and beyond the requirements of state licensure in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ts. Requirements for BCTMB certification are passing the Board Certification Exam, completion of 24 hours of continuing education biannually, passing a criminal background check and agreeing to uphold the Standards of Practice & Code of Ethics of the National Certification Board for Therapeutic Massage & Bodywork.
